What will I be doing? As Groups, Conference and Events Sales Manager, you promote the services and facilities of the cluster Hotels to all customers and Guests and cross sell the other products within the Hilton family of brands. The Conference and Events Sales Manager oversees all Conference and Events Sales offices to ensure active conversion of customer enquiries. Specifically, you will be responsible for performing the following tasks to the highest standards: Develop future and repeat business contributing to the profitability of the hotel Review the business plans, identify gaps and ensure proactive efforts to fill capacity and meet set targets Contribute to the selling strategy of the hotel, and manage the departments' adherence to achieving that strategy Understand the competitive market place and implement approaches to ensure the Hotel stays ahead in the local market Ensure Sales Team Members are developed effectively and generate a culture of high quality standards for relationship building, customer service, selling techniques, and billing and processing contracts Manage and develop the Conference and Events Sales Team to ensure career progression and effective succession planning within the hotel and company Build strong relationships with customers, Guests and Team Members in order to gain full understanding of their needs and work to serve them effectively Manage staff performance in compliance with company policies and procedures Recruit, manage, train and develop the Conference and Events Sales Team What are we looking for?
